VIDEO & PHOTOS: Fire Breaks Out At Daulatabad Fort In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ar
The historic Daulatabad Fort in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ar caught fire on Tuesday afternoon. The fire was so massive that it soon engulfed the surroundings of the fort.

According to the information received, some tourists who went to the fort saw flames in the dried grass around the fort at around 10am. They ignored it, but the fire soon started spreading and the dried grass and bushes around the fort were caught in the flames. The fire took a massive form at around 1pm. The nearby residents informed the police and the fire brigade. Three fire tenders rushed to the spot and started the work of extinguishing the fire.


The temperature in the district is rising now. It is said that the fire broke out due to the scorching heat, but the exact reason for the outburst of the fire was not known. As of now, no loss of lives has been reported and the work of extinguishing the fire continued till late afternoon.
Officials said that the fire started from the Kala Kot area of the fort. The fire spread from all sides of the fort due to the wind. The wooden logs and bridge of the Baradari also got engulfed in the clutches of the fire.
On receiving the information, Daulatabad police, Archaeological Survey of India (ASI) officers and fire brigade officers rushed to the spot. The fire fighting jawans could not start the extinguishing work due to the complicated geographical structure of the fort. The fire tenders could not reach the fire spot.
Moreover, there had been no fire safety measures adopted by the ASI in the fort. The jawans and the nearby residents tried hard to extinguish the fire. The Chand Minar was also seen engulfed in smoke.
